What is the difference between Azure Devops Specialist vs Cloud Engineer?

AspectAzure Devops SpecialistCloud Engineer
CertificationsAzure DevOps certifications, Azure certificationsAzure, AWS, Google Cloud certifications
Work EnvironmentDevOps teams, software development projectsCloud infrastructure, deployment, and management
Industry UsageIT, software development, tech companiesIT, cloud service providers, enterprise IT
Primary FocusCI/CD pipelines, automation, Azure DevOps toolsCloud architecture, deployment, infrastructure management

While both roles work within cloud and DevOps environments, an Azure Devops Specialist primarily focuses on implementing and managing CI/CD pipelines using Azure DevOps tools, whereas a Cloud Engineer handles broader cloud infrastructure and architecture across multiple platforms. The roles often overlap but differ in scope and specialization.

Is Azure DevOps in high demand?

Azure DevOps specialists are in high demand due to the widespread adoption of cloud-based development and continuous integration/continuous deployment (CI/CD) practices. Organizations seek professionals skilled in Azure tools, automation, and DevOps processes to improve software delivery efficiency and reliability.
